About this webinar:

Every year, more than 1 million Americans come together in more than 8,000 Lights On Afterschool events in all 50 states and the District of Columbia. Like afterschool programs, Lights On Afterschool celebrations can be whatever you make of them; events come in all shapes and sizes, and don't have to cost a lot to be effective.

Whether this is your first Lights On Afterschool or your 19th, in this webinar we will go over everything you need to help stay on track with your planning for this year's celebration. Learn about steps you can take now to help build champions for afterschool in your community, and learn more about what you can do to make sure community leaders and policy makers see firsthand how afterschool is working for kids and families in your community.

Featuring presentations from the Alliance's own Dan Gilbert and Afterschool Ambassador Sierra Newhouse-Ragoonanan from After-School All-Stars Orlando, this webinar will provide insights on how to use our extensive event planning tools and go over all of the basics to help you stay on track with your planning, attract VIPs, and work with the media to get your message out.
